Appreciate a clear concise review without non-value added narrative! I have a 23 with 5600km and agree 100% on every point. Had high expectations due to reviews and the 300 Rally exceeded every one. As mentioned the handling off road is where I was most surprised. The weight and fuel efficiency/range, are key items for me. The comfort level due to tank and windscreen fairings as well as seat position is awesome. Never thought about it but your comment "sitting in it vs on it" is right on the money. Rode 2-up with a 65kg passenger (I'm 86kg) and other than rear suspension sag was amazed at how well it did on hills, and in general on and off road. I travel in dark at times and the headlight is impressive as well. Also noticed for whatever reason the bikes on-road visibility to automobiles seems very good.
